Magnesium is an essential element for our body to function properly. A significant proportion of French people suffer from magnesium deficiency. Sportsmen and women, pregnant women and the elderly are most at risk. Magnesium deficiency leads to fatigue, nervousness, cramps, etc. Why take a course of magnesium malate?

LERECA® Magnesium Malate is an innovative combination of natural ingredients designed to reduce stress and help the body recover from stress-related fatigue:
Marine Magnesium helps reduce fatigue, supports normal nervous system function and energy metabolism.
Magnesium works in synergy with group B vitamins, particularly vitamin B6, which enables its metabolism.
Group B vitamins are important for normal nervous system functioning and boosting energy metabolism.
Citrulline Malate is a combination of citrulline (an amino acid) and malate, which potentiates its action.
Ginseng promotes vitality and helps with fatigue, stress and convalescence.

2 capsules per day to be taken with a glass of water.
PRECAUTIONS FOR USE :
This dietary supplement should be used in conjunction with a varied diet. Do not exceed the recommended dose. Store away from heat and moisture. Keep out of the reach of children.
Ingredients for 2 capsules:
Contents: marine magnesium (200 mg magnesium = 53% NRV), bulking agent maltodextrin, citrulline malate (140 mg), ginseng root extract (30 mg).
Anti-caking agents : Magnesium stearate and silicon dioxide [nano] E551, vitamin B6 (2 mg = 142% NRV), vitamin B1 (1.4 mg = 127% NRV), vitamin B9 (200 µg = 100% NRV).
Envelope of plant origin :
Hydroxypropylmethylcellulose.
NRV: Dietary Reference Value
Find magnesium in magnesium-rich foods: oilseeds, green vegetables, wholegrain cereals, etc. Drink magnesium-rich water. Oxygenate your body by taking regular walks in the fresh air. Limit your consumption of alcohol, coffee and tobacco, as they limit the proper absorption of magnesium. Eat at regular times, with fresh fruit and vegetables at every meal. Take magnesium cures, such as easily-assimilable marine magnesium.
